Bombardier only sells back to the 1996 model year. They will direct you to the original publisher, Ken Cook Co., in Milwaukee: 414-466-6060 ext 292.
You can contact Ken Cook direct and they will sell you an original. They are also on the web. The only problem with the last one I purchased was that they are no longer printed copies with color. They are black and white photocopies. OK for most servicing, but lack in the electrical schematics where color is a must..
